Copy and paste from the link:

Surprise! Disney PhotoPass" Service has opened the doors to a new online experience for Walt Disney World® Guests.


Introducing MyDisneyPhotoPass.com which features a fresh new look, organizing your photos in a timeline that allows you to relive your vacation memories as they happened. You will also have access to new stickers featuring Character signatures and Disney icons.

What This Means to You

My Photos

Your current photos will still be available at DisneyPhotoPass.com for you to share, create and purchase until their expiration date. Photos from DisneyPhotoPass.com will not be moved or accessible at MyDisneyPhotoPass.com.

Saved Projects

DisneyPhotoPass.com saved projects will be available for you to edit and purchase until the photos in your project expire. Saved projects will not be moved to MyDisneyPhotoPass.com. We recommend you complete and purchase any projects before your photos expire.

New Registration

MyDisneyPhotoPass.com is a part of the Disney.com family of sites and your current DisneyPhotoPass.com log in will not work at MyDisneyPhotoPass.com. You will need to complete a new registration or sign in using an existing Disney account. If youve registered with a site like MyDisneyExperience.com, disneyworld.com, ABC.com or ESPN.com, you can use the same member name and password.

Disneyland® Resort, ESPN Wide World of Sports Complex (Gameday Photos) and Aulani, A Disney Resort & Spa Guests

At this time only Walt Disney World® Guests will have access to MyDisneyPhotoPass.com. All other Guests will continue to view, edit and purchase their photos at DisneyPhotoPass.com. Disneyland® Resort, ESPN Wide World of Sports Complex (Gameday Photos) and Aulani, A Disney Resort & Spa photos will not be available at MyDisneyPhotoPass.com.

Expiration Policy Has Changed

Disney PhotoPass photos, dining photos and attraction photos in your account will expire 45 days from the date the photo was taken.

If you would like to extend the expiration date to 60 days from the date the photo was taken, you may purchase an expiration extension. All photos in your account as of the day the expiration extension is purchased will now expire 60 days from the date the photo was taken (instead of 45 days). Expiration dates of photos may only be extended once.

My DisneyPhotoPass.com does not offer options for permanent storing of photos. Expired photos will be deleted from the system.

Walt Disney World® Resort Guests

If your most recent vacation started on or after September 4th, please select Walt Disney World® to view your photos in our new website. If this is your first time visiting MyDisneyPhotoPass.com, you will need to register for an account to access your photos.

If your most recent vacation started prior to September 4th, view your Disney memories here.

Not happy about losing all the editing time. Now it is 45 days from the date the photo is taken, not 30 days to claim and 30 days to edit after that. Plus, there is only one 15 day extension allowed.


But what I also noticed on the products page is there no longer appears to be any choice of photopass or photopass+ CD. They now only have a single "photopass" CD listed and it is priced at $169. In their FAQs they do still talk about both, so maybe they just haven't completed the product page and the website isn't finalized yet?
 
I see they have added 15 days to the 30 and 45 day timelines, now 45 and 60 days.

No, it looks like they have taken away 15 days. You used to be able to claim them up to 30 days out and then have 30 days to play and order your cd. Now you have 45 days from the first swipe of the card, but you can add 15 days if you need, but you have to pay.
 
Yes, I saw that from stitchkingdom this morning. It's just 45 days total, from the time the first picture is taken. :(
